Much of my work is about the small, seemingly mundane things and the importance of these moments; especially those spent in the company of others. The lockdown period taught us many things, one of which was how we crave human contact and connection. With that in mind, I’ve created three pieces that celebrate these moments – physical and digital manifestations of the beauty of these fleeting moments.

A physical three-screen video sculpture, Moments Spent with Others is a representation of three memories in my life, creating abstract forms derived from imagery and sounds of those memories, seen from three different perspectives at the same time.

Featured in my inaugural solo show at Gazelli Art House, May 2022.
